The military power in the Roman republic was the same as it had always been -- the Roman army. Whoever led the army, or at least a few legions, could hope for supreme power if he wanted it. Men such as Marius, Sulla, Pompey and Caesar used their legions to gain power.

There are no specific restrictions on when he can use his military power. He does not have to ask permission to order military action. Only Congress can declare war and appropriate the money for long-term military action, so that is something a check on his use of military force.
The Resolution was that the UK gained it's islands back, and Argentina's Military Junta fell from power. Galtieri had used the islands to cover up Argentina's failing economical conditions, but this backfired on the UK's sucess. This also greatly boosted Margret Thatcher's Government, which is what Galtieri tried to do, but failed, and the people who were cheering in Buenos Aires was later rioting.
